
VP Operations
Christopher M. Trendell
Chris’s construction experience begins in Oxford, England as a teenager. Working in the family’s painting and interior renovation business, Chris was immersed into the challenge of managing an integrated construction operation. Following five-years working with his father, Chris joined a demolition and salvage company with focus on deconstruction of architecturally relevant structures.
Immigrating to the United States in 1989, Chris was immediately employed by the Berg Family working in their scrap steel operation as a laborer. Chris’s leadership and organizational skills were quickly recognized, and he was moved into the Berg’s demolition division quickly promoted to superintendent. Following 10 years of service, he was promoted to Vice President of Operations and has now designed and overseen over five hundred million dollars of successfully completed demolition projects.
Presently Chris’s major focus is in the mentorship and development of our operations contingent in safety, trade and business matters.
